[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]I think the class isn’t so hard but the exam is very hard.[/quote] No. If you experience this, it means the instructor was too lax! DS had that situation in his online AP Calc AB class during the pandemic: he didn't realize the teacher was glossing over the harder bits of the class, and he got a low score on the exam. After that, he was proactive in checking with the College Board curriculum and taking practice tests. A good AP teacher will put students through exam-level homework and tests all throughout the year and not miss any unit of instruction.[/quote]
